  ###  [Hearing Screenings](/departments/pediatric-specialty-care/deaf-and-hard-hearing-collaborative/patient-resources/hearing-screenings) 

 A hearing screening uses a special machine to see how your baby responds to sounds. In MA, all babies have their hearing screened when they’re born. 

 

 

 ###  [Understanding Childhood Hearing Loss](/departments/pediatric-specialty-care/deaf-and-hard-hearing-collaborative/patient-resources/understanding-childhood-hearing-loss) 

 The number of children who are deaf and hard of hearing (DHH) varies by age, with the numbers increasing with age. Hearing differences can be mild, moderate, severe, or profound. 

 

 

 ###  [Deafness and Hearing Loss Resources for Families](/departments/pediatric-specialty-care/deaf-and-hard-hearing-collaborative/patient-resources/deafness-and-hearing-loss-resources-families) 

 If your child is d/Deaf or hard of hearing, it can affect your whole family. A variety of resources are available to help both you and your child find support and education.
